A comprehensive Career Advancement Programme in Film Score Editing provides specialized training for aspiring and experienced professionals seeking to elevate their skills in this dynamic field. The program focuses on advanced techniques in audio post-production, sound design, and music integration within the filmmaking process.
Learning outcomes typically include mastering industry-standard Digital Audio Workstations (DAWs) such as Pro Tools and Logic Pro X, proficiency in sound effects editing, mixing, and mastering, and a deep understanding of music theory and its application in film scoring. Students also develop crucial collaborative skills, essential for working effectively within film production teams.
The duration of such a program varies, but many intensive courses range from several months to a year, offering a balance of theoretical knowledge and hands-on practical experience through individual and group projects. Real-world case studies and industry guest lectures further enhance the learning experience.
